Well i might have known I’d get the phone call as soon as I had posted.  Appointment day is next Wednesday which will make it 20 days between GP and tests, if that is useful to anyone else.

 

Full day of tests with results the same day at the Royal Berks

I was diagnosed at the end of November 2012. I went to my GP who arranged my referral on the internet for one week after my appointment with her. I had mammogram and ultra sound scan with biopsy there and then. 2 weeks later I went for results, although from what they said at US I already knew I had bc. 3cm, grade 3 ER+/PR+/HER2-   so things went pretty smoothly for me really. I had my tests at the Nottingham Breast Institute which is based at the Nottingham City Hospital, chemotherapy at the same hospital.
